Buoyant Enterprise for Linkerd and VMware Tanzu Platform compete in the cloud-native service mesh management category. Buoyant Enterprise for Linkerd offers lightweight and high-performance features that appeal to resource-conscious operations, while VMware Tanzu Platform provides a comprehensive suite of features, appealing to enterprises seeking a complete platform solution.
Features: Buoyant Enterprise for Linkerd is appreciated for its simplicity, efficiency, and robust security capabilities, making it an ideal choice for rapid deployment with minimal overhead. It is designed for those who need a solution that is easy to implement and manage. VMware Tanzu Platform is recognized for its extensive integration capabilities across hybrid and multi-cloud environments. It provides a broad array of tools for application lifecycle management and is suitable for organizations needing extensive integration and scalable solutions.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Buoyant Enterprise for Linkerd is noted for its straightforward, modular deployment process, enabling quick setup and easy scalability. Its customer support is responsive and knowledgeable, making it easy to resolve issues quickly. VMware Tanzu Platform requires a more complex deployment process due to its broad array of services, but it benefits from extensive documentation and a robust support network, supporting complex enterprise needs with a thorough service approach.
Pricing and ROI: Buoyant Enterprise for Linkerd offers competitive pricing with quick ROI due to efficient resource utilization and low setup costs. This approach makes it attractive for cost-conscious organizations. VMware Tanzu Platform, although requiring a greater initial investment, provides a substantial ROI through its extensive capabilities and long-term strategic value for cloud-native transformation. While Linkerd attracts with low costs, Tanzu justifies its higher price by delivering expansive functionalities that offer significant business value.

Buoyant Enterprise for Linkerd stands out in the landscape of cloud-native solutions by providing an out-of-the-box service mesh layer which is tailored for modern distributed systems. It is designed to integrate seamlessly with existing Kubernetes environments, offering an enhanced layer of security, observability, and reliability. Known for its lightweight architecture, it reduces resource consumption while providing effective routing, failure handling, and detailed telemetry for better service management.

VMware Tanzu Platform is designed for cloud-native development and management of Kubernetes, CI/CD processes, microservices, and containerized workloads. It supports deployments both on cloud and on-premises, providing centralized management via Mission Control.
VMware Tanzu Platform offers seamless integration with vSphere, ESX, and vSAN, supporting centralized cluster management and lifecycle management. The platform provides a GUI for monitoring CI/CD pipelines and network policies, enhancing multi-tenancy and Day 2 operations. Users can easily manage Kubernetes clusters, monitor applications, and integrate with tools such as GitHub, GitLab, Cloud Foundry, and Azure. It ensures compliance and security for service providers, financial institutions, and businesses.
